Dubai Set To Host First World Congress Of Neurosurgery In The Middle East In December 2025

Dubai will host the 19th World Congress of Neurosurgery in 2025, marking the first time this prestigious event takes place in the Middle East. The successful bid was led by the Emirates Society of Neurological Surgeons with support from Dubai Business Events, part of the Dubai Department of Economy and Tourism.

The congress, themed ‘Connecting the Neurosurgical World’, is a key event for the World Federation of Neurosurgical Societies (WFNS) and occurs biennially. Scheduled for 1st to 4th December 2025, it will attract around 4,000 delegates, including industry leaders and innovators.

The WFNS's decision to hold the congress in Dubai underscores the city's rapid growth as a hub for international conferences. According to the International Congress and Convention Association (ICCA), Dubai ranks highest in the Middle East for hosting association events.

Ahmed Al Khaja, CEO of Dubai Festivals and Retail Establishment, stated, "The decision by the World Federation of Neurosurgical Societies to bring this prestigious event to Dubai is a testament to the evolution of our knowledge economy, driven by the city’s visionary leadership. It also further highlights the platform that Dubai is able to provide to associations around the world for sharing knowledge, networking, and professional development."

Dubai's focus on attracting business events aligns with its Economic Agenda D33, aiming to double its economy by 2033. The city’s convention bureau collaborates with various sectors to expand its event portfolio. A notable initiative is the Al Safeer Congress Ambassador Programme which engages local experts to secure international events.

Dr. Mohamed Al-Olama expressed pride in bringing global neurosurgery experts to Dubai. He noted that their skills would significantly benefit medicine and enhance Dubai’s reputation as a preferred venue for specialised gatherings.

Infrastructure and Innovation: Key Attractions

The Administrative Council of WFNS praised Dubai as an ideal location for such an event. They highlighted its infrastructure, business-friendly environment, and leisure options as reasons why it stands out for large-scale global gatherings.

"There is no better place in the world than Dubai to bring the neurosurgical world together," they stated. "Science, technology and innovation have been the hallmarks of Dubai’s knowledge economy – and we are delighted that the World Congress of Neurosurgery will be held in such a vibrant and dynamic city."

This congress will not only draw leading figures from neuroscience but also business leaders and innovators. It positions Dubai at the forefront of scientific advancement.
